Step-by-step explanation:

We would use the Law of Sines, [tex] \frac{sin(A)}{a} = \frac{sin(B)}{b} =\frac{sin(C)}{c} [/tex]

Applying the formula, let's find b°:

Thus:

[tex] \frac{sin(b)}{3.6} = \frac{sin(100)}{5.1} [/tex]

Cross multiply

[tex] sin(b)*5.1 = sin(100)*3.6 [/tex]

Divide both sides by 5.1

[tex] sin(b) = \frac{sin(100)*3.6}{5.1} [/tex]

[tex] sin(b) = 0.69516 [/tex]

[tex] b = sin^{-1}(0.69516) [/tex]

b = 44.0399685° ≈ 44.04° (2 decimal places)
